There's some changes made to this design, as I always do. The major one was removing some pink (!!!) to replace with yellow on the centermost butterfly, the one with the orange and purple. The pink just looked... absurd, I'm sorry. I didn't like it so I changed it. The second most obvious change would be some added sparkle, the butterfly in the lower right didn't have any sparkle (...? Why?) so I went ahead and added some in. The rest of the changes are minor but frequent, which is to say they're all over the place but I wouldn't know how to point them all out to you. These are tiny things like moving a backstitching point up one square or removing/adding a stitch that looked out of place.

I don't do a lot of work on printed fabric but I'm pretty pleased with this design's use of it. It gives it a lot of texture that would have been a major pain in the butt to add otherwise.
